From Publishers Weekly

Beyond a basic agreement about walking as the ideal exercise (it's safe, low-intensity and requires no investment other than a pair of good shoes), the approaches of these two books, both April publications, could hardly be more different. Fenton and Bauer, editors at Walking magazine, offer an encouraging, commonsensical guide to a progressive walking program designed to make even die-hard couch potatoes say, "I can do this." Breezy, two-page chapters?one for each day of the training regime?offer information on such topics as stride, step and pacing and include space for the essential daily log-keeping. The authors' positive approach to walking matches the book's easy-to-follow structure. By contrast, Malkin (Walking?The Pleasure Exercise), a dental surgeon, delineates the "Malkin Technique" in an authoritative, nearly pedantic style. He urges a minimum of three 45-minute sessions of brisk ("moderate to hard") walking per week, offering an eight-week training program toward that goal. Chapters discuss health, weight loss, stretching, equipment and motivation; those dealing with diet include some low-fat recipes. The surfeit of information and the moving focus of attention make for a daunting prospect, a view that could easily spill over to the fitness program Malkin prescribes.
Copyright 1995 Reed Business Information, Inc.


Product Description

Slim down, tune up, and feel better in eight weeks

With proper technique, aerobic walking is one of the safest and most beneficial forms of exercise and a terrific way to lose weight. Now from bestselling health and fitness expert Dr. Mort Malkin offers a complete, step-by-step aerobic walking program that you can customize to reach your personal fitness and weight-loss goals. Drawing on the latest scientific findings on proper walking techniques, weight loss, safety, and nutrition, Dr. Malkin explains everything you need to know to walk your way to a slimmer, healthier you, including how to:

  • Reduce stress and lower your blood pressure
  • Control your appetite
  • Determine how far, fast, and often to walk for your health and fitness level
  • Slow down, and even reverse, osteoporosis
  • Select the best footwear and accessories

Here is a complete program that will bring you a healthier and more satisfying life.

4.0 out of 5 stars For the motivated or advanced walker, June 12, 2000
This book was fairly easy to read although it can be technical at times. The book is a good second or third step to walking for fitness but tends to leave out the beginning walker and does little to help motivate the couch potato. The book does give good advice on the importance of warming up and cooling down. Overall a good book, but not for beginners.

5.0 out of 5 stars Thoroughly informative!, January 4, 2002
By Rizzo (Denver, CO) - See all my reviews
(TOP 1000 REVIEWER)      
Dr. Mort Malkin is one of the nation's leading authorities on aerobic walking. He has developed clinics, programs, seminars across the states. Also, check out his other best seller, "Walking, The Pleasure Exercise."

Malkin's first attempt to persuade you to walk aerobically us by convincing you how good you will look. He will focus on the fundamentals of the whole esthetic picture, your weight, shape, posture, presence and grace, yes, grace; he believes the conveniences of modern civilization have made us into sitters instead of walkers. The computer world alone has us sitting more than ever. As for presence, Dr. Malkin says aerobic walking will bestow a more youthful appearance.

You will learn plenty on the aerobic diet guide for reducing, he informs us on carbs, proteins, fats, water, vitamins, fiber, foods with grains, salad vegetables, green and yellow vegetables, starches, dairy, fruits, etc.,

In the chapter called "How Far, How Fast, How Often", he discusses an 8-week program that is simply increasing your pace from 15 minutes at a gentle pace, every other day to 45 minutes at a very brisk pace every other day. That's all that is in the 8-week program, a doable increase in pace and time.

Included is plenty of info on preventing injuries. This is an excellent book...MzRizz

5.0 out of 5 stars A good choice for beginners, January 16, 2002
By A Customer
Malkin's book is excellent for the beginner. I can say that because I am one.
All Malkin wants is for people to reap the benefits of exercise, all their lives, and enjoy it at the same time. His program is so hassle-free that you think it's under-acheiving, but it works.
With the facts, and a sense of humor, Dr. Malkin shows that walking is the ultimate win-win exercise, with lasting benefits.
He gives you all the basics you need, plus refined techniques, to integrate walking into your life effortlessly. Not only that, you don't have to do it every day, if you don't want to...
